Bonjour,
Je souhaite votre aide pour solutionner mon problème.
Je dispose de données que j'ai collectées dans un .txt
Elles sont formatées de la façon suivante :
Ca, c'est la règle générale.
Je souhaiterais importer uniquement les champs lignes nom/adresse/codepostal ville dans une cellule à chaque fois.
Donc obtenir le rendu suivant :
avec le ALT+ENTER qui va bien en fin de ligne.
Bien sûr il y a des cas particuliers vu que le .txt provient d'un export de pdf. Parfois il n'y a pas de saut de ligne :
Parfois l'adresse complète est sur 2 ligne ou même 1 ligne ... :
ou
Je pense qu'obtenir quelque chose de correct dès l'import est compliqué, l'idée est de vous solliciter pour un traitement des cellules pour obtenir le résultat attendu.
Merci de votre aide.
Je souhaite votre aide pour solutionner mon problème.
Je dispose de données que j'ai collectées dans un .txt
Elles sont formatées de la façon suivante :
VB:
ORD-du texte inutile
nom
adresse
codepostal ville
ORD-du texte inutile
nom
adresse
codepostal ville
ORD-du texte inutile
etc...
Je souhaiterais importer uniquement les champs lignes nom/adresse/codepostal ville dans une cellule à chaque fois.
Donc obtenir le rendu suivant :
VB:
cellule1 contenant
nom
adresse
codepostal ville
cellule2 contenant
nom
adresse
codepostal ville
cellule3 contenant
nom
adresse
codepostal ville
avec le ALT+ENTER qui va bien en fin de ligne.
Bien sûr il y a des cas particuliers vu que le .txt provient d'un export de pdf. Parfois il n'y a pas de saut de ligne :
VB:
codepostal ville
ORD-du texte inutile
VB:
nom adresse
codepostal ville
VB:
nom adresse codepostal ville
Je pense qu'obtenir quelque chose de correct dès l'import est compliqué, l'idée est de vous solliciter pour un traitement des cellules pour obtenir le résultat attendu.
Merci de votre aide.
Pièces jointes
Dernière modification par un modérateur: